What Is The Approach Warning Light on A Forklift?

In the realm of industrial operations, forklifts play a pivotal role in material handling and logistics. Ensuring safety in environments where forklifts operate is paramount, not only for the operators but also for pedestrians and other machinery. One innovative solution that has gained prominence is the approach warning light on a forklift. This technology serves as a preventive measure to reduce accidents by alerting nearby personnel of an approaching forklift. This article delves into the intricacies of forklift approach warning lights, exploring their functionality, benefits, and implementation strategies to enhance workplace safety.


Understanding Forklift Approach Warning Lights

Forklift approach warning lights are specialized lighting systems installed on forklifts to project a visible warning signal on the floor ahead or behind the vehicle. Typically, these lights emit a bright blue or red beam, forming a distinct spot or line on the ground. This visual cue alerts pedestrians and other operators of the forklift's presence and direction of movement, especially in noisy or obstructed environments where auditory warnings like horns might be insufficient.

Mechanism of Action

The mechanism behind forklift approach warning lights involves high-intensity LEDs that project light onto the floor several meters ahead or behind the forklift. By casting a bright, noticeable spot or line, these lights provide an early warning system. The use of blue light, in particular, is due to its high visibility and contrast against typical warehouse floors. This technology is especially useful at blind corners, intersections, and trailers where visibility is limited.

Types of Warning Lights

There are various types of forklift warning lights designed to cater to different safety needs:

  • Blue Spot Lights: Project a bright blue spot or beam on the floor to indicate the forklift's path.

  • Red Zone Lights: Create a visual boundary around the forklift to keep pedestrians at a safe distance.

  • Arc Lights: Emit a curved line on the floor, highlighting the swing radius of the forklift.

  • Strobe Lights: Provide flashing warnings to attract immediate attention in high-risk areas.

The Significance of Forklift Safety Lights

Implementing forklift safety lights is a proactive approach to mitigate accidents. According to the Occupational Safety and Health Administration (OSHA), forklifts are involved in about 85 fatal accidents and 34,900 serious injuries each year in the United States. Enhancing visibility through warning lights addresses some of the common causes of these incidents, such as poor visibility and lack of awareness among pedestrians.

Enhancing Forklift Safety with Blue Lights

The adoption of forklift safety lights, particularly blue lights, significantly enhances workplace safety. The bright blue beam is easily noticeable and can cut through peripheral distractions, alerting individuals to the forklift's approach. This is crucial in busy industrial settings where noise levels are high, and visibility is often compromised by shelving, equipment, or other obstacles.

Implementing Forklift Approach Warning Lights

For organizations looking to enhance their safety measures, the implementation of forklift approach warning lights should be systematic and strategic.

Assessment of Workplace Environment

Before installation, it's essential to assess the working environment to identify high-risk areas. Factors to consider include:

  • High pedestrian traffic zones

  • Poorly lit areas

  • Blind corners and intersections

  • Noise levels that may drown out auditory signals


Selection of Appropriate Lighting Solutions

Choosing the right type of warning light is critical. Companies like Creek offer a range of forklift safety lights tailored to various operational needs. Factors influencing the selection include the brightness of the LED, the shape and size of the projected light, and compatibility with existing forklift models.

Installation and Maintenance

Proper installation ensures the effectiveness of the warning lights. It's advisable to have qualified technicians handle the installation, ensuring that the lights are securely mounted and correctly angled. Regular maintenance checks are necessary to ensure the lights remain functional, including checks on the LED intensity and the integrity of the mounting brackets.

Training and Awareness

While technology plays a significant role, human factors are equally important. Training programs should be implemented to educate forklift operators and pedestrians about the meaning of the warning lights and the appropriate responses.

Operator Training

Operators should be trained on the proper use of the warning lights, understanding their responsibility in activating and maintaining these safety features. Emphasis should be placed on:

  • The importance of visual warnings in enhancing safety

  • Regular checks to ensure the lights are operational

  • Reporting any malfunctions promptly


Pedestrian Awareness Programs

Employees working in proximity to forklifts should be made aware of the warning signals. Awareness programs can include:

  • Recognizing the blue and red light warnings

  • Understanding safe distances when a forklift is approaching

  • Procedures for navigating areas where forklifts operate


Technological Advancements and Future Trends

The field of forklift safety is continually evolving with advancements in technology. Innovations are aimed at integrating warning lights with other safety systems to create a comprehensive safety network.

Integration with Proximity Sensors

Modern systems are combining visual warnings with proximity sensors that can detect obstacles and automatically adjust the intensity or pattern of the warning lights. This integration enhances the responsiveness of the safety system to real-time conditions.

Smart Forklift Technology

The advent of the Internet of Things (IoT) has led to the development of smart forklifts equipped with connected devices. These forklifts can communicate with facility management systems to monitor forklift locations, usage patterns, and maintenance needs, further improving safety and efficiency.

Frequently Asked Questions (FAQ)

1. What is the primary purpose of an approach warning light on a forklift?

The primary purpose is to enhance safety by projecting a visible warning signal on the floor, alerting pedestrians and other operators of the forklift's presence and direction, thereby preventing accidents.

2. Why are blue lights commonly used for forklift safety lights?

Blue lights are highly visible and provide a strong contrast against typical warehouse floors, making them effective in attracting attention and signaling the forklift's approach in various lighting conditions.

3. How do forklift approach warning lights contribute to OSHA compliance?

While OSHA doesn't mandate specific warning lights, implementing them demonstrates an employer's commitment to providing a safe work environment, aligning with OSHA's general duty clause and safety guidelines.

4. Can forklift safety lights be integrated with other safety systems?

Yes, modern forklift safety lights can be integrated with proximity sensors and IoT devices, forming part of a larger, interconnected safety system that enhances real-time responsiveness and monitoring.

5. What factors should be considered when selecting a forklift warning light?

Consider the brightness and color of the LED, the pattern of light projection (spot, line, arc), compatibility with forklift models, durability, certification standards, and the specific needs of the operating environment.

6. Are there legal requirements for installing warning lights on forklifts?

Legal requirements vary by country and region. While some regulations may not specifically mandate warning lights, employers have a general obligation to ensure workplace safety, which can include the use of such technologies.

7. How often should the forklift approach warning lights be inspected?

Regular inspections should be conducted as part of routine maintenance schedules, ideally before each shift, to ensure that the lights are functioning correctly and any issues are addressed promptly.
